Based on 129 recent sales, the median property price is £133,500 (about £150 per square foot) in Wallsend Central area, with individual transactions ranging from £42,500 up to £685,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 5 | £367,500 | £213 |
| Semi-Detached | 24 | £185,000 | £206 |
| Terraced | 53 | £150,000 | £153 |
| Flats | 47 | £87,750 | £139 |

Postcode NE28 7QP is located in a major urban area, within the Wallsend Central ward of North Tyneside in the North East region, and forms part of the Wallsend West area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 125.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, in line with the North East average of 117 per 1,000. The average income per household in Wallsend West is £36,878 per year. The nearest station is Heworth, about 2.9 miles away. There are 7 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There are 6 parks nearby, the closest large park is Richardson Dees Park.
Wallsend West has a very high level of deprivation, ranked at position 5,307 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 16% most deprived areas in England.
Wallsend West has a very high crime rate, with approximately 125.4 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 5.9%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 25.5% of dwellings are socially rented.
The average income per household in Wallsend West is £36,878 per year.
High noise level (70.0-74.9 dB) from road, approximately 70 ft away from NE28 7QP.
Wallsend West near NE28 7QP has no flood risk (less than 0.1%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
